William Shatner is going to ride Jeff Bezos’ rocket into orbit next month. And he’ll film his flight aboard the Blue Origin rocket for a documentary.
Just this month, Shatner was featured in an excellent video in which he reacted to impressions of himself.
At 90 years old, that’ll make him the oldest person ever to go to space. The previous record was just set back in July, by 82-year-old Wally Funk.
